Comprehending Spanish Pharmaceutical Regulations
Spain preserves a strict regulative structure relating to the sale of pharmaceuticals to guarantee public safety. Governed by the Spanish Agency for Medicines and Health Products (Agencia Española de Medicamentos y Productos Sanitarios-- AEMPS), the nation imposes European Union instructions on distance selling.
The essential rule governing online pharmacies in Spain is simple: prescription-only medications can not be offered online.
What Does This Mean for Painkillers?
Painkillers cover a large spectrum of strength and risk, varying from moderate anti-inflammatories to potent opioids. As a result, their legal online schedule varies significantly:
Over-the-Counter (OTC) Painkillers: Mild analgesics like basic ibuprofen or paracetamol can be sold online, however only by authorized brick-and-mortar pharmacies that have actually gotten federal government approval to run an online storefront.Prescription Painkillers: Stronger analgesics-- consisting of high-dose NSAIDs, muscle relaxants, tramadol, codeine-based mixes, and other opioids-- can not legally be purchased online without a legitimate prescription. Due to the fact that of the high danger of counterfeit drugs sold on the uncontrolled internet, the European Union and Spain presented a necessary typical logo design for legal online drug stores.
When looking for a legitimate digital drug store based in Spain, users should try to find the main EU security logo. Clicking this logo design must redirect the user to the main federal government computer registry (Distafarma) verifying the pharmacy's physical license.

The web is rife with rogue sites advertising "no prescription required" pain relievers delivered directly to doors in Spain. Engaging with these unlawful operations brings serious dangers:
Counterfeit or Subpotent Drugs: Laboratory analyses of unapproved online drug stores regularly reveal tablets containing incorrect does, harmful impurities, or zero active pharmaceutical active ingredients.Legal Consequences: Importing prescription drugs or managed substances from worldwide sources outside established legal channels breaks Spanish customizeds and drug laws, potentially resulting in bundles being taken and legal charges.Absence of Medical Supervision: Pain can be a sign of a serious underlying condition.
